Meanwhile, the streaming landscape has undergone its own revolution. Indonesia's premium streaming subscriber base expanded to 26.9 million accounts in 2025, with Netflix, Vidio, Viu, and iQiyi all contributing to the gains. The market reached a historic milestone in Q4 2025 as Indonesian productions equaled Korean programming in viewership share at 30% each, while both content types reached nearly identical portions of the user base at 47-48%. "This is a meaningful shift that reflects improving content quality, stronger distribution and rising audience confidence in local storytelling," said , lead analyst at Media Partners Asia and AMPD.

Labels like 88rising have helped Indonesian talent break into Western markets. Artists like Rich Brian, NIKI, and Warren Hue have proved that Indonesian youths can successfully headline major Western festivals like Coachella, blending global hip-hop and R&B with subtle nods to their heritage. 3. She laughed, recalling the names. "We had Suzzanna , our Queen of Horror, starring in films like Beranak dalam Kubur . We had Warkop DKI , a comedy trio—Dono, Kasino, and Indro—who made movies that were essentially stand-up comedy on film. They poked fun at the government and society. It was raw, silly, and undeniably Indonesian. We didn't need special effects; we had charisma."
